.. _struct_CONFIG_DIGITAL_WELDING_INTERFACE_MONITORING: CONFIG_DIGITAL_WELDING_INTERFACE_MONITORING =========================================== This structure defines the **digital I/O mapping for real-time welding monitoring signals**. It connects digital channels to various process feedback values, such as voltage, current, wire feed, and error diagnostics. Each entry utilizes :ref:`C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A ` to specify mapping, bit offset, and value range. .. list-table:: :widths: 10 30 20 8 32 :header-rows: 1 * - **BYTE#** - **Field Name** - **Data Type** - **Value** - **Remarks** * - 0 - ``_tWeldingVoltage`` - :ref:`C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A ` - - - Real-time voltage feedback mapping * - 15 - ``_tWeldingCurrent`` - :ref:`C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A ` - - - Real-time current feedback mapping * - 30 - ``_tWireFeedSpeed`` - :ref:`C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A ` - - - Wire feed speed monitoring channel * - 45 - ``_tWireStick`` - :ref:`C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A ` - - - Detects wire stick events or blockages * - 60 - ``_tError`` - :ref:`C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A ` - - - Error status monitoring (binary fault indicator) * - 75 - ``_tErrorNumber`` - :ref:`C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A ` - - - Detailed error code mapping for diagnostics Total size: 90 bytes **Defined in:** ``DRFS.h`` .. code-block:: cpp typedef struct _CONFIG_DIGITAL_WELDING_INTERFACE_MONITORING { /* Real-time voltage monitoring */ C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A _tWeldingVoltage; /* Real-time current monitoring */ C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A _tWeldingCurrent; /* Wire feed speed feedback */ C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A _tWireFeedSpeed; /* Wire stick or jam detection */ C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A _tWireStick; /* Error status flag */ C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A _tError; /* Error code mapping */ CONFIG_DIGITAL_WELDING_IF_MAPPING_DATA _tErrorNumber; } CONFIG_DIGITAL_WELDING_INTERFACE_MONITORING, *LPCONFIG_DIGITAL_WELDING_INTERFACE_MONITORING; .. note:: - Provides **real-time process monitoring** over digital interfaces. - ``_tError`` and ``_tErrorNumber`` allow both binary and numeric fault reporting. - Ideal for **digital welding controllers** supporting feedback through fieldbus or GPIO mapping.
